Light & Fluffy Yogurt Cloud Cake

Description

A light and fluffy cake made with yogurt that melts in your mouth, perfect for cozy afternoons and serves as a delightful dessert.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 cup plain yogurt (preferably Greek yogurt)
  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 cup granulated sugar
  • 4 large eggs, separated
  • 1/4 cup vegetable oil
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on cream of tartar (optional)
  • 1/2 cup heavy whipping cream
  • 2 tablespoons powdered sugar
  • 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ract (for whipped topping)

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ease an 8-inch round cake pan with parchment paper.
  2. In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the yogurt, vegetable oil, and vanilla extract. Add in the egg yolks along with granulated sugar, stirring until everything is smooth and unified.
  3. In a separate bowl, sift together the flour, baking powder, and salt. Gradually fold this dry mixture into the wet ingredients, taking care to stir gently.
  4. In a clean bowl, beat the egg whites with cream of tartar until soft peaks form. Gradually add a tablespoon of sugar and continue whisking until you achieve stiff peaks.
  5. Gently fold the egg whites into your cake batter in two or three additions.
  6. Pour the batter into the prepared cake pan and bake for 25-30 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
  7. Allow the cake to cool in the pan for about 10 minutes, then transfer to a wire rack to cool completely.
  8. For the whipped topping, beat together the heavy cream, powdered sugar, and vanilla extract until stiff peaks form.
  9. Once the cake is cool, spread the whipped cream over the top and serve with fresh berries or a dusting of powdered sugar.

Notes

For an even fluffier cake, use room temperature egg yolks and whites. Infuse yogurt with citrus zest for added flavor.
